WOODBRIDGE, N.J. (AP) - Firefighters have gained the upper hand on a large brush fire in central New Jersey that threatened ammunition storage at a gun range.
The fire broke out late Wednesday afternoon in Woodbridge Township, near the junction of Interstate 287 and the Garden State Parkway.
The Home News Tribune (https://mycj.co/1osZC8b ) reports flames came within 25 feet of an ammo rack at a gun range in the Keasbey section of the township.
The flames also reportedly had spread to several tractor-trailers in a parking lot.
Plumes of thick black smoke could be seen for miles before firefighters gained control and rain helped extinguish the blaze.
The cause of the blaze remains under investigation.
